What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summer season warm a little bit, but it likewise pulls wetness right into autumn and springtime. Winters are chilly and prolonged, and the cold water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That vast delta from inlet to setpoint temperature indicates your heater works harder for even more months of the year. Gas designs cycle more often. Electric elements run longer sessions. Tankless systems are pushed to the upper edge of their circulation rankings when two fixtures open at once.

Hard water substances the anxiety. Lots of Chicago neighborhoods examination at modest to high hardness, which increases scale build-up on electric elements and gas-fired heat transfer surface areas. I have drained tanks where the bottom 6 inches were obstructed with crunchy mineral sediment, reducing efficient capability and covering up th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is an additional perpetrator, particularly in cellars with older single-pane home wind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Burning appliances need air, however way too much unchecked air cools the container and flue, increases condensation, and triggers intermittent flame-sensing faults.

If your water heater is near an outside wall surface or in a garage, the results turn up quicker. Burners corrosion. Air vent ports drip. Condensate pools where it shouldn't. Plan for assessment and service cadence that appreciates these truths. A heating unit that would certainly run eight to ten years in a light climate could need focus by year six here.

How to Spot Trouble Before It Spikes

Most failings provide cautions. You just require to recognize them and act. A few area notes:

A warm water supply that turns from warm to scalding and back suggests a failing thermostat or clogged up mixing shutoff. On gas systems, irregular temperature typically begins after debris has actually blanketed the bottom, creating locations that perplex the control.

Popping, rolling, or a gravelly audio during heater cycles almost always indicates range and debris. The noise is heavy steam standing out beneath layers of mineral buildup, which likewise takes efficiency. In worst situations the rolling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ted warm water that gets rid of after a couple of mins typically indicates an anode pole has actually been taken in and the storage tank is starting to wear away. If the discoloration sh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the building's piping, yet do not reject the heating unit without drawing the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ature level and pressure relief valve can be misleading. If the valve weeps only throughout a heating cycle after that stops, thermal development might be driving pressure beyond the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with closed systems or examine shutoffs on the water meter often need an appropriately sized development tank. If the valve weeps constantly, replace it and test system pressure.

Intermittent hot water on a tankless system when you open up a single low-flow faucet can indicate the minimum circulation sensor isn't being caused.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is a typical cause. Do not keep elevating the temperature level to compensate, you'll produce a scald threat and still obtain warm water.

Gas scent, blister marks, or residue around the burner area implies closed it down and call a specialist. In older basements with lint and animal hair, I commonly locate flame rollout evidence from blocked combustion air intakes.

If you capture problems early, water heater service in Chicago runs smoother and more affordable. Numerous issues fall into the repairable category if you're proactive.

Repair or Replace: The Real Equation

I do not use a strict age cutoff, yet age matters. The majority of standard gl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ly maintained. In units with neglected anodes or severe water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a clean burner and sound controls, interior container wear ends up being the coin throw you won't such as. If the storage tank itself leakages,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is greater than a momentary bandage.

For fixing candidates, I look at part expenses, access, and expected horizon. Changing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ats commonly makes sense for younger units. So does switching a stopped working heating element on an electrical version. Anode rods are affordable insurance, and I have replaced them on containers as old as year 9 when the interior still looked good. Yet if the heater assembly is corroded, the flue baffle is warped, or you can't isolate the leak without pressurizing, I push house owners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ains usually tip the balance. Newer gas or hybrid electrical versions make use of much less energy per gallon delivered, and tankless devices have actually enhanced regulating controls that respond much better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the right capability or a tankless system addresses both integrity and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system does not go after peak draw, it meets it without throwing away gas the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ains trickier when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an additional bath.

For tanks, overall washroom matter, tenancy, and component routines drive the selection. A home of 4 with two complete baths and typical morning overlap rarely is sorry for a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the recuperation price is solid. A 40-gallon version can help self-displined routines, yet if both showers run and washing begins, it will certainly falter. Electric storage tanks need larger abilities to match the recuperation of gas. I usually sp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ric families with 2 or more baths.

For tankless, match the system to the chilliest anticipated incoming tem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ago winters months, prepare for a temperature surge of 70 to 85 degrees. 2 showers plus a sink may call for 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that increase. Suppliers listing circulation capacity at particular delta-T values. Check out those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If space permits, some two-flats benefit from two smaller tankless systems in parallel instead of one oversized device, which improves redundancy and regulates extra effectively on low draws.

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Long Lasting Choice

There is no generally finest choice. Your gas line dimension, venting path, electrical capacity, and space layout determine what's practical. After that the math of energy rates and your use patterns finish the picture.

Traditional gas container water heaters sit in the wonderful area of expense, uncomplicated installment, and reputable recovery. They recognize to examiners and solution technologies. If you have a suitable chimney or a direct-vent path, they work well in most Chicago cellars. They are sensitive to make-up air and airing vent condition, which is why you must inspect the flue consistently for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ing layouts uses PVC airing vent and can be more effective, particularly when you can not count on a stonework chimney. They require an appropriate condensate drainpipe line that won't ice up. The air vent runs should be pitched to drain, and the discontinuation must be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ric containers are simpler mechanically, with no combustion or airing vent to bother with. They can be outstanding in apartments or structures without gas. The compromise is recuperation rate and electric load.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a large electrical heater might require a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heatpump hot water heater shine in removed homes with enough area and moderate ambient temperature levels. They pull warmth from the surrounding air and are really effective. In Chicago basements, they still work, but they cool down and evaporate the space. That can be a benefit in summer season, a downside in winter.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, specifically if the device is near a living area. I've mounted hybrids in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ste heat helps, but in small mechanical closets they can struggle.

Tankless gas units liberate flooring room and provide endless warm water within their circulation limitations. They are delicate to water top quality and require normal descaling. Venting is generally secured and sidewall-terminated, which frequently streamlines flue issues. They do need appropriate g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Properly mounted and maintained, they last a very long time and keep costs predictable.

Chicago Structure Truths: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access

Venting is where lots of DIY efforts go laterally. Older two-flats and cottages frequently share a chimney flue between the hot water heater and a climatic heater. If the heating system obtains changed with a high-efficiency design that vents via PVC, the hot water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That transforms draft features and threats condensation inside the masonry. I have actually determined flue gas temperatures that drop too quickly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this path, take into consideration an appropriately sized steel liner or switch over the heater to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's allowing process for water heater setup is uncomplicated when you follow code and supply standard documents. Anticipate gas pressure examinations for new or revised lines, burning air computations if you are staying with climatic appliances,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, inspectors also take a look at b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Organizing is easier midweek and outside vacation weeks. If your structure is an apartment, consider board authorizations and elevator reservations for relocating tanks.

Access forms labor time. Yard systems with narrow gangways and low stairwell turns limitation storage tank size simply since you can't physically steer a bigger cylinder. I've had jobs where a 50-gallon tank needed to be taken apart to get rid of, after that we shifted to a tankless to stay clear of future gain access to migraines. Procedure doorways, transforms, and ceiling elevations before you choose a model.

Maintenance That In fact Prolongs Life

Yearly service defeats shock failures. In our climate, the following cadence jobs. Drain a couple of gallons from the tank every six months to flush debris. Full flushes are perfect if the shutoff is robust, but I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s snap. If the valve really feels flimsy, a partial drain and refill is more secure. On electrical tanks, kill power first and inspect element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es dissolve promptly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ow smell issues from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it longer. If you don't have above clearance, use a fractional anode. When anodes are ignored, the tank comes to be the sacrificial steel, and failure accelerates.

For gas versions, vacuum dust and dust from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ing poles carefully with a fine rough pad. Inspect that the flame is stable and mainly blue with well-defined cones. Lazy yellow flames suggest inadequate burning or blocked air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the burner runs. If smoke spills out, stop and deal with venting.

Tankless units need annual descaling in the majority of Chicago areas. Make use of a pump, hose pipes, and a descaling solution to flow via the warmth ex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ing models. I have actually seen neglected tankless systems run with half the anticipated circulation since the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ion containers are entitled to a stress check also. With the system cool and pressure eased, the growth tank's air side need to match your home's fixed water pressure, generally 50 to 60 psi. A water logged expansion container creates nuisance TPR discharges and shortens the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Require Specialist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ago

Some troubles are safe to explore on your own, like examining the breaker, relighting a pilot per the guidebook, or flushing sediment. Others warrant a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, burn marks, and repeating TPR discharges drop in that classification. So do new electric runs for crossbreed or large electric tanks and any modification to gas lines.

An excellent service see isn't just a quick swap of a part. Anticipate a technology to test gas pressure, clock the meter if required, measure burning or aspect existing, confirm draft, and check for indications of moisture. If you're obtaining price quotes for water heater fixing in Chicago, ask what the diagnostic consists of. You want more than a guess.

Realistic Price Ranges and What Drives Them

Costs vary by access, brand, warranty, and code requirements. An uncomplicated f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as storage tank may land in a modest range, while a control valve or electric component could be higher. Full hot water heater installment in Chicago for a typical atmospheric gas storage tank normally includes the device, new flex adapters, drip leg, TPR piping to code, permit, and haul-away of the old container. Include expenses for a brand-new smokeshaft liner if called for, or for a power-vent model with lengthy vent runs and condensate drain configuration.

Tankless installations have a larger spread. If the gas line have to be upsized and the vent gas water heater installation route pierced through masonry with a long run, the labor boosts. Descaling valves and seclusion sets water heater replacement add price upfront but conserve running expenditure later. Hybrid heat pumps cost greater than typical electric tanks, and you may require a condensate pump, resonance seclusion pads, and possibly a tiny air duct package to enhance airflow.

Ask for detailed quotes so you can see where the money goes. Reduced quotes that omit license fees, airing vent upgrades, or development tanks usually swell later on or lead to a system that functions poorly.

Practical Steps Property owners Can Take Today

A short, targeted checklist maintains you ahead of problems without diving into specialist territory.

  • Locate and label the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heating unit. Technique transforming them off.
  • Check the TPR valve discharge pipeline. It should terminate within a couple of inches of a drain or pan, not capped. If you see energetic leaking, routine service.
  • Note your heater's age from the identification number. If it mores than 8 years for gas or ten for electrical, prepare for replacement, not just repairs.
  • Test warm water recovery. Time the length of time it requires to recuperate after a shower. A sudden adjustment typically signifies debris or control issues.
  • Clear a two-foot distance around the device. Keep combustibles away and ensure airflow.

That listing covers the essentials without going across into work that ought to be entrusted to a technician. If anything appears off throughout these checks, connect for expert water heater solution in Chicago before winter collections in.

What I would certainly Recommend alike Chicago Scenarios

In an older block cottage with an audio smokeshaft and a household of 4, a 50-gallon climatic gas storage tank stays a trustworthy, cost-effective option, offered the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Add a correctly sized growth storage tank and routine annual flushes.

In a yard unit with minimal accessibility and just one bathroom, a compact tankless can free space and take care of two fixtures simultaneously if sized properly for wintertime inlet water. Strategy a descaling routine and install isolation valves from day one.

In a condo with no gas, an 80-gallon electric thermostat replacement water heater container offers comfortable healing if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is tight and you desire efficiency, a hybrid heatpump works if you approve a cooler storage room and set up condensate correctly. I've seen homeowners app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.

For two-flat owners who supply warm water to tenants, redundancy issues. Two medium tankless units in parallel with a controller provide versatility. If one fails, the other maintains fundamental solution while you wait on parts. This configuration additionally regulates better at reduced need than a single oversized un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the first tough freeze, walk the outside. If your heating unit vents with a sidewall, Chicagoland plumbing services inspect the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Confirm the termination is high enough over grade to prevent snow obstruction. Inside your home,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ped which traps contain water to prevent exhaust recirculation.

During long cold wave, listen for brand-new rattles or changes in heater noise. Unexpected increases in burner noise or long term shooting cycles frequently associate flue restrictions or heavy sediment movement. On very windy days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from pressure disruptions near the air vent. Proper air vent termination positioning minimizes this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In springtime, humidity climbs and cellar wetness increases. Look for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ipples on top of the storage tank. I typically see early rust at these joints from minor sweating, not from leakages. A basic wipe-down and inspection regular when a month tells you a lot.

What Makes an Excellent Installment, Not Just a Brand-new Heater

A cool mount is greater than clean piping. It means right burning air computations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between dissimilar ste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It indicates the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the pan under the heating system, if made use of, has a drainpipe to someplace that can handle water. It also means practical conversation concerning water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, a straightforward scale in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

Documentation matters. Keep your license, version numbers, guarantee details, and a fundamental service log. When you call for water heater repair in Chicago years later, handing a technology those notes saves diagnostic time and minimizes billable hours.

Frequently Asked Questions About Water Heater in Chicago


How much does it cost to install a water heater in Chicago?

The cost to install a water heater in Chicago typically ranges from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type, size, and labor. Tankless water heaters are generally more expensive than traditional tank models. Additional factors like plumbing modifications or permits can increase the total cost.

How much does a water heater cost in the USA?

The average cost of a water heater in the USA 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on size and type. Traditional tank water heaters are usually less expensive than tankless or high-efficiency models. Installation and labor costs are extra and vary by region.

Which is the No. 1 water heater brand?

Rheem is widely recognized as one of the top water heater brands in the United States. Other leading brands include A.O. Smith, Bradford White, and Bosch. Brand preference often depends on reliability, efficiency, and warranty offerings.

How much does heating cost in Chicago?

Heating costs in Chicago vary by home size and fuel type, but the average monthly heating bill ranges from $100 to $300 during winter. Natural gas is typically the most cost-effective option, while electricity and oil can be more expensive. Efficiency of the heating system also significantly affects costs.

Do you need a permit to replace a water heater in Chicago?

Yes, a permit is generally required to replace a water heater in Chicago. This ensures that the installation meets building codes and safety standards. Licensed plumbers are typically responsible for obtaining the necessary permit.

Does Costco sell water heaters?

Yes, Costco sells water heaters, primarily online and in some warehouse locations. They offer various sizes and types, including tank and tankless models. Availability may vary by region.

How much does it cost to install a regular water heater?

Installing a standard tank water heater typically costs between $800 and $1,500, including labor. Costs vary based on size, model, and any required plumbing or electrical modifications. Tankless systems generally cost more to install.

How much does a 50 gallon water heater cost?

A 50-gallon water heater usually costs between $400 and $900 for the unit alone. Installation costs can add $300 to $800, depending on labor and any additional plumbing work. Tankless water heaters of similar capacity are more expensive.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.

What type of water heater is cheapest to install?

The cheapest water heaters to install are typically standard tank water heaters. They have lower upfront costs and simpler installation requirements compared to tankless or high-efficiency models. However, operating costs may be higher than more efficient options.

What can a homeowner do without a permit in Chicago?

In Chicago, homeowners can generally perform minor repairs, cosmetic improvements, or maintenance without a permit. This includes tasks like painting, flooring replacement, and some electrical or plumbing repairs that do not alter the system. Any work involving new installations or major system changes usually requires a permit.
